Olin Corporation Provides Update on Hurricane Beryl

Jul. 10, 2024 4:10 PM ETOlin Corporation (OLN)

CLAYTON, Mo., July 10,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Olin Corporation (NYSE: OLN) announced a temporary disruption of operations at its Freeport, Texas, facility as a result of Hurricane Beryl.

Olin has declared a system-wide Force Majeure for its Chlor Alkali Products & Vinyls division products and Aromatics shipments. This disruption is a result of hurricane-related damage to Olin facilities in Freeport, Texas, impacting Olin’s normal production and logistics capabilities including access to power, raw materials, and other essential feedstocks and services.

Olin facilities in Freeport are undergoing a comprehensive inspection and assessment, and a coordinated plan is being developed to ensure the safe and orderly return of these plants to service. The duration of this disruption is uncertain.

Olin’s number one priority remains the safety of our employees, their families, and the communities in which we operate.
